Therapeutic approaches offered online
Emma James uses a blend of evidence-informed methods to support clients in an online setting. Attachment-Based Therapy focuses on how early relationships shape current patterns of relating - it helps people understand attachment needs and improve closeness and trust in relationships. Client-Centered Therapy places the client at the heart of the work, offering empathic listening and nonjudgmental support to help people explore their feelings and make choices that fit their values.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) is used to reduce the intensity of distressing memories by processing them in a structured way; it is often helpful for trauma-related symptoms.Finding the right approach is part of the therapeutic process.
